Spencer, Iowa (NorthwestIowaNow.com) — Upgrades to the Spencer Aquatic Center are still a priority for the Spencer Parks and Recreation Board, and Bob Fullhart gave an update on the progress:

The Spencer City Council will see the final design plans at an upcoming meeting, and they’ll need to discuss the three separate bond issues including the splash pad, aquatic center and camping. They are first waiting to hear from Bonding Companies on how to proceed.

Ice Skating is back for now, too.

No zamboni, but the parks crew will work to keep the surface clean on Moose pond. You can use your own ice skates, or you can contact the Parks department to check out ice skates for free.
